restarting an unused car
I have a 1982 RX-7 GS with the 12A engine and 63,000
miles. It ran fine when it was last used, about 10 years ago. I am looking for advice on how to go about getting it back up and running. Any help would be appreciated.

pour Marvel Mystery oil down the carby and let it sit for a while... then try to start it. You don't want stuck apex seals poping out just because they were sitting in there.
Actually, I'd recommend pulling the plugs and trying to spin the engine over by hand. (put wrench on the E-shaft bolt and spin it over.)

I would flush everything and replace all the filters, spark plugs, and seriously consider a close inspection of the carburetor. I purchased a rx7 that had been setting up for 4 years and the carburetor was gummed up real bad.
